Transaction 4c574e7f6fd2aa93113bd7e110aa19d31b8ec523f863a862a3d8439e5253912e

1 Input
2 Outputs
  • 4c574e7f6fd2aa93113bd7e110aa19d31b8ec523f863a862a3d8439e5253912e:0
  • value  9606811
    address  3AMik51YxsTnu6CvSuHdwSoAR9oxVggPGE
  • 4c574e7f6fd2aa93113bd7e110aa19d31b8ec523f863a862a3d8439e5253912e:1
  • value  1708742
    address  3MpcwQskZ6ahoYouGQmjHnSuUDbrsYzryJ